Historical Events on May 23

  • Joan of Arc

    1430

    Joan of Arc is captured by the Burgundians while leading an army to raise the Siege of Compiègne.

  • Piracy

    1701

    After being convicted of piracy and of murdering William Moore, Captain William Kidd is hanged in London.

  • Mexican-American War

    1846

    Mexican-American War: President Mariano Paredes of Mexico unofficially declares war on the United States.

  • American Civil War

    1900

    American Civil War: Sergeant William Harvey Carney is awarded the Medal of Honor for his heroism in the Assault on the Battery Wagner in 1863.

  • World War I

    1915

    World War I: Italy joins the Allies, fulfilling its part of the Treaty of London.

  • Brazil

    1932

    In Brazil, four students are shot and killed during a manifestation against the Brazilian dictator Getúlio Vargas, which resulted in the outbreak of the Constitutionalist Revolution several weeks later.

  • World War II

    1945

    World War II: Heinrich Himmler, head of the Schutzstaffel, commits suicide while in Allied custody.
